Written by Chris Hannan, What Shadows is a Midlands story that follows the events around Conservative politician Enoch Powell and his attempts to address the issue of immigration in 1960s Britain.

With racial hatred among ethnic communities on the rise, Powell’s famous ‘Rivers of Blood’ speech in 1968 changed the face of immigration forever.

It drew a significant division between Whites and people of Colour resulting in an unprecedented number of hate crimes.

The play follows two separate timelines, one of Enoch putting together his speech in the late 1960s and the second following esteemed Oxford scholar of Caribbean descent, Rosie Cruickshank who interviews Powell in 1992:

Identity is the hallmark of Hannan’s play.

What does identity mean to an individual, whatever their background or ethnicity?

Ian McDiarmid is chillingly believable as the universally vilified Enoch Powell.

While the play centres around the infamous speech, Hannan is careful to draw out the humanity of his protagonist.

Powell struggles to understand his own place in the world, what England means to him and his own English identity.

Supporting Enoch is an excellent cast that includes Rebecca Scroggs as Rosie Cruickshank, Waleed Akhtar as Saeed, Phaldut Sharma as Sultan, Bríd Brennan as Sofia Nicol, Paula Wilcox as Grace Hughes, and George Costigan as Clem Jones.

Each present to the audience a different layer of identity. With Brexit Britain on our doorstep, What Shadows is a startling reminder of Powell’s incensed prophecy of how communities divide and turn against each other.
